Stock Track | CleanSpark Plunges 8.41% on Q1 Earnings Miss and Bitcoin Market Selloff

CleanSpark, Inc. (CLSK) shares experienced a 24-hour plunge of 8.41%, with significant pressure occurring in post-market trading on Thursday.

The sharp decline followed the company's release of disappointing first-quarter fiscal 2026 results. CleanSpark reported a loss of $1.35 per share, dramatically missing analyst estimates for a loss of $0.15 per share. Revenue of $181.18 million also fell short of the $195.54 million consensus. Furthermore, the company's adjusted EBITDA was a loss of $295.4 million, a severe miss compared to the expected profit of $75.1 million.

The negative sentiment was compounded by a broad selloff in cryptocurrency markets. Bitcoin plummeted below $60,000, erasing gains and triggering widespread instability. As a Bitcoin mining company, CleanSpark's stock is particularly sensitive to such market movements, leading to increased selling pressure alongside other crypto-related equities.
